Decouple limits on number of LUNs per port and LUs per CTL.
Those two values are not directly related, so make them independent. This does not change any limits immediately, but makes number of LUNs per port controllable via tunable/sysctl kern.cam.ctl.lun_map_size. After this change increasing CTL_MAX_LUNS should be pretty cheap, and even making it tunable should be easy. MFC after: 2 weeks
